Output 83ee4bb8a9e458ade61e3063276f201e1d4a679db00a692d3276f80f8a23a677:1

value
150319137
script pubkey
OP_0 OP_PUSHBYTES_32 68388dccc59f8113a81ea49bc24e0d75aeef8705cbce4777b893d587125d9615
address
bc1qdqugmnx9n7q382q75jduynsdwkhwlpc9e08ywaacj02cwyjajc2szkmfs4
transaction
83ee4bb8a9e458ade61e3063276f201e1d4a679db00a692d3276f80f8a23a677
confirmations
76925
spent
true